>I've noted before that it's always the smallest changes which incite
>the greatest number of follow-ups, and we frequently see the situation
>where something like NFS or the audio subsystem is just crawling with
>bogons and nobody says spit about them.  Then someone makes a small,
>relatively cosmetic change and everybody is on their chairs, exerting
>tremendous energy on the issue.

It's called "the Parkinson principle", which paraphrased goes something
like "You can get permission to build a nuclear plant, because people
do not understand it so they dare not object or they would show their
ignorance.  But try to get permission for a bike-shelter..."
